Welcome To Advising

Whether you are a prospective or current student, parent, or counsellor, Program Advisors are here to help you. Today’s educational and occupational opportunities are many and complex. We can help you make a well-informed decision on the program that fits your career goals. We’ll ensure that you have all the information you need to apply and to be successful at BCIT.

Connect with a Program Advisor by telephone, in-person/virtual, or by email.

Full-time studies program advisors can provide information on:

  • Program selection and program content
  • The admissions process and program entrance requirements
  • Strengthening your application to a competitive program
  • Where graduates are finding jobs, typical job titles, and salaries
  • Appropriate upgrading options or assessment exams
  • What it takes to manage the rigor of a BCIT program through to graduation
  • Transfer credit, advanced placement, and prior learning assessment evaluation
  • Student life and accessing internal and external resources for success at BCIT

Flexible learning program advisors can assist with or provide information on:

  • Determining the right program to meet your career goals
  • Course options and selection for Flexible Learning programs
  • Applying for transfer credit and advanced placement
  • Work and life balance while attending BCIT Flexible Learning programs
  • Making changes to your approved program plan
  • Program laddering options
  • Program and course costs
